Advice Needed on UoL BSc (Hons) Computer Science by SkillKiller3010 in UniversityOfLondonCS

[–]airesblair 5 points6 points  (0 children)

I'm coming to the end of my final year, and it's possible to receive a first class, just ensure that you maximize your midterms and these weigh somewhere between 30 to 50 % of the final. My only regret was my very first semester. I had a medical emergency with my family, and it showed in my grades. The courses are really good and most are fun, I would always suggest using your own environment to code and not depending on their IDE. However, I've not seen any serious errors , I advise you to use the Slack channel and speak with seniors. The community is mostly willing to help. I started fresh and unable to code and I think I'm a much better coder than I was when I started 2 years ago.

What can I do to get ahead and my current game plan by M200294 in UniversityOfLondonCS

[–]airesblair 1 point2 points  (0 children)

Hey sorry was finishing midterms, yes those are correct. In first year you will do intro to programming 1 and 2 ( one each semester) and that's Javascript. You will also have a webdev course in first year. So the course will help. W3schools also has a DAS course(free) that will help with Data scrructures ( 1st year). How computers work is pretty straight forward just be ready to read. As well as fundamentals of comsci Discrete math and computational math for these you have to use alot of YouTube TrevTutor was pretty helpful.

What can I do to get ahead and my current game plan by M200294 in UniversityOfLondonCS

[–]airesblair 3 points4 points  (0 children)

Hey as someone that was very new and is still learning coding, I would suggest using code train on YouTube, for Js. W3schools. Also I went on udemy and paid for 2 courses one in js ( web dev) and the other in py, both from Dr. Angela Lu.

On w3schools they have a course on DSA ( data structures and algo ) this will help you alot. For discrete maths and computational math YouTube provides very good resources. That should be good to get you started and soaring through the first year and a good part of 2nd year ( which I'm now in). Hope that helped.
